What is the Steam Deck?

Before we dive into the answer, let’s take a step back and understand what the Steam Deck is. The Steam Deck is a handheld gaming console developed by Valve Corporation, the same company behind the popular digital distribution platform, Steam. It’s essentially a portable version of your PC, allowing you to play a wide range of games on the go. The Steam Deck is designed to be a powerful device, with a custom AMD processor, 16 GB of RAM, and a 7-inch touchscreen display.

Method 2: Emulation

Another way to play Pokémon games on the Steam Deck is through emulation. This involves using a third-party emulator to run the game on the Steam Deck, rather than relying on Nintendo’s official software. Emulation can be a complex and potentially risky process, as it may not work correctly or may violate Nintendo’s terms of service. However, if you’re comfortable with the risks and have the necessary technical knowledge, you can try using an emulator like Citra or NR to play Pokémon games on the Steam Deck.
